Sustain

We are the first Church to pilot the Sustain Project in partnership with Barnabus (a Christian Charity that works with those experiencing homelessness) designed to help establish their clients who are on their resettlement scheme. Together with Barnabus we have trained 6 volunteers from Church to befriend, help, and bring long term support with life skills, building community, combating loneliness and breaking the cycle of homelessness.

"It’s been a great success, the client is no longer in debt, has the confidence to travel by bus on her own and even knows how to make her own pasta, all things that were not possible before she met the team from St Philips.  This relationship has now even led the client to attend the Alpha course as she is helping to cook alongside one of the Sustain team, having never set foot in a church before. We are so excited to see where this relationship can go.”.
Partnership Manager at Barnabus
